Provided by Tiger Fintech (Singapore) Pte. Ltd.

Mersana Therapeutics Inc.

0.5012
-0.0431-7.92%
Post-market: 0.51790.0167+3.33%17:23 EDT
Volume:2.16M
Turnover:1.12M
Market Cap:62.47M
PE:-0.89
High:0.5453
Open:0.5453
Low:0.4889
Close:0.5443
Loading ...
no data

No relevant data is available